SK52 NGG is a 2002 Honda Ses 125-2 in Red with a 125c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2002 Honda Ses 125-2 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.2% with a typical mileage of 15,789 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da Ses 125-2 fails its MOT is shock absorber seal failed and leaking oil, accounting for 81 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SK52 NGG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Ses 125-2 typ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 24 years old, this Honda Ses 125-2 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
